Water Temperature Prediction for Protecting Endangered Sea Life
In the Laguna Madre, the longest hypersaline lagoon in the United States, the passage of cold fronts can lower air temperature by more than 10°C in less than 24 hours. Some of these cold-water events result in large fish kills and sea turtle cold stunning. We are providing critical information through our AI water temperature prediction model to industrial decision makers and wildlife volunteers.
Winter Road Weather: Decision Making
Severe winter weather poses significant challenges for roadway safety. We have developed an AI product that provides real-time, automated identification and prediction of road weather conditions for the New York Department of Transportation (NYSDOT). Our solution will deliver real-time decision-support tools to help NYSDOT rapidly assess and respond to hazardous winter road conditions.


Hail Nowcasting in Partnership with Industry
In a collaboration with government researchers at NOAA’s National Severe Storms Laboratory and private industry researchers at Vaisala, NSF AI2ES created an AI approach to nowcasting hail and convective initiation. The model is currently being operationalized and refined into a product at Vaisala.
